I recently had the memory card in the RaspberryPi fail; but, was able to 
recover the database file and most of the data in it.  A new card was used 
to make a new install of raspbian and weewx version 4.10.2.  After I got it 
up and running it read the pending data from the Davis memory.  Later, I 
added the data from the old database file to the database, deleted the 
report files, ran  wee_database --calc-missing and wee_database 
--rebuild-daily.  After that the statistics looked good; but, the NOAA 
climate data report shows the formula instead of the result for the 
calculated columns.  Instead of a number for heating degree days I 
have   $month.heatdeg.sum.format($Temp,$NONE,add_label=False); but, in the 
high / day / low / day  columns have  83.6   03    35.7   24.

This happens for the default skin:   http://aj4nr.com/Weather/index.html 
And the Belchertown skin: http://aj4nr.com/Weather/belchertown/

The installation is pretty much a stock installation, I added FTP of 
folders to the WWW server.  I started with the SQLite database; but, now 
I'm using MariaDB that is hosted by a Windows server. It was doing this on 
the SQLite and MariaDB databases. I have not modified any of the reporting 
templates.
